Radar Insights into Antarctic Ice Dynamics
This chapter explores the application of radar technology in examining the West Antarctic ice sheet, revealing subsurface features critical for understanding ice flow and melting. The discussion highlights the importance of different radar frequencies in analyzing ice structures while sharing personal experiences from challenging field research in Antarctica. Through this narrative, listeners gain insights into both the technical aspects of radar research and the logistical complexities of ice studies.
